Clark Township is one of nine townships in Johnson County, Indiana. As of the 2010 census, its population was 2,460 and it contained 863 housing units.[4]

History

Clark Township was organized in 1838.[5] It was named in honor of the Clark family of pioneer settlers.[6]

The Heck-Hasler House was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2000.[7]

Geography

According to the 2010 census, the township has a total area of 34.44 square miles (89.2 km2), of which 34.43 square miles (89.2 km2) (or 99.97%) is land and 0.02 square miles (0.052 km2) (or 0.06%) is water.[4]
